In AC-4 duty at 400 V it carries 15.5 A, covering reversing and inching duty on squirrel-cage motors where the contacts see full locked-rotor current each cycle.
Side-by-side mounting is permitted, which keeps the rail density high when grouping multiple contactors in a motor control centre. Screw-type terminals on both the main current circuit and the auxiliary/control circuit accept solid or stranded conductors: 2x (0.5 to 1.5 mm²) and 2x (0.75 to 2.5 mm²) for the control wiring, and up to 2x 10 mm² for the main power wires. The pollution degree is rated 3, meaning the contactor is designed for industrial environments where conductive pollution may occur — no additional conformal coating required for a standard panel.
For Type 1 coordination (contactor may need replacement after fault), a 100 A gL/gG fuse is allowed. These values define the maximum short-circuit protection the contactor can withstand without welding or exploding; the actual fuse size should be selected per the motor full-load current and the coordination study for the panel. Above 40 °C, derating of the continuous current may apply — consult the thermal curve for the specific duty class.
